HOLIDAYS ARE BETTER WHEN YOUR DOG CAN COME TOO.

This inspiring guide is packed with brilliant ideas for dog-friendly adventures across Europe. Featuring 25 unforgettable holidays in France, Spain, Portugal, Germany, the Netherlands, Italy, Belgium, Switzerland and the United Kingdom.

But it’s not just about where dogs are allowed – it’s about the places they’ll love as much as you do – think vineyard strolls through Portugal’s Douro Valley, steam train rides through Germany’s mountains, sniffing out sausages in Spain and soaking up the architectural wonders of Barcelona.

Each chapter centres on a ‘bucket list’ destination, with thoughtfully handpicked recommendations for the best places to stay, sights to visit, local dishes to try and the best spots to enjoy them – all guaranteed to welcome you and your four-legged friend with open arms.

With gorgeous photos, practical planning advice and plenty of detail about enclosed gardens, off-lead areas and year-round dog-friendly beaches, this book will give you the confidence to go further, with your best friend by your side every step of the way.

So pack the treats and the travel bowls – it’s time for the trip of a lifetime with your pup.

Lottie Gross is a travel writer and dog lover who has spent a number of years dragging her dogs along on adventures for work. She has written for The Telegraph, The Times, the Independent, the i paper, DK, Rough Guides, Lonely Planet, and many more. She regularly speaks at dog events such as DogFest and Dogstival, and on radio and television for the BBC and ITV. She is the author of the Bradt guide Dog-Friendly Weekends (2022) and the Bloomsbury book Dog Days Out (2024). @lottiecgross
